| There are several titles used for nobility and positions of honor throughout the [[Everwind Series]]. Only those of Royal Houses typically hold Daeken titles or their equivalent, with Baeron and Earlenships being held by Vassal Houses, though there are a few exceptions. It is also possible to hold titles in other countries. For example, [[Rylen of Brummel]] lives in [[Andermark]], but he holds the title of [[Baeron]] of [[Irnley]], which applies to [[Praul]].

| ==Primary Ranks==
| |
| *''Emperor'' - only [[Vralius Claverian]] holds this title, often as "High Emperor"
| |
| *''King'' and ''Queen''
| |
| **King Regent - one who rules in the stead of the actual king until he becomes of age; [[Nurius 12 of Andergard]] is a king regent
| |
| **Queen Consort - the wife of a king
| |
| **Queen Regnant - a queen who rules in her own right; [[Caliana of Sable]] is a queen regnant
| |
| **Queen Regent - a queen who rules in the stead of the actual king until he becomes of age
| |
| **Queen Dowager - the wife of a deceased king; Caliana of Sable is one but uses the higher "regnant" title
| |
| **Queen Mother - a queen dowager who is also the mother of the reigning sovereign
| |
| *''[[Crownprince]]'' and ''[[Crownprincess]]'' - a prince or princess who is next in line to the [[High Seat]]
| |
| **''Prince'' and ''Princess'' - offspring of a king and queen
| |
| *''[[Viceroy]]'' - a position appointed by any sovereign power which acts in their stead as governors over a particular region
| |
| *''Crowndaeken'' and ''Crowndaekeness'' - a Daeken or Daekeness who is next in line to the High Seat; a prince/princes who is also a daeken/daekeness may choose which they prefer. [[Falder of Brant]] is a Crowndaeken; [[Averlyn of Sable]] is a Crowndaekussa
| |
| *''[[Daeken]]'' and ''[[Daekeness]]'' - similar to a Duke, almost always held by those of [[Royal Houses]]
| |
| *''[[Daekus]]'' and ''[[Daekussa]]'' - (Averia)
| |
| *''[[Baeron]]'' and ''[[Baeroness]]'' - baron and baroness, highest title allowed to be held by those of [[Vassal Houses]]
| |
| *''[[Baerus]]'' and ''[[Baerussa]]'' - ([[Averia]])
| |
| *''[[Earlen]]'' and ''[[Earleness]]'' - below baeron in station, held by Vassals
| |
| *''[[Earlus]]'' and ''[[Earlussa]]'' - (Averia)
| |
| *''[[Saer]]'' - similar to Sir, though does not denote knighthood or even nobility

| ==Titles of Custom or Courtesy==
| |
| *''Your Virtue'' - what they call the Queen in [[Averia]]
| |
| *''Your Excellence'' - used for the sovereign king and queen of a given nation state
| |
| *''Lord'' and ''Lady'' - used for members of noble houses and those of royal houses who are not heads of state
